How do we know Jesus is the key to salvation?

Answered in 1 source

Jesus is described in Revelation 3:7 as holding the key of David, indicating His exclusive authority to grant access to salvation.

Revelation 3:7 explicitly states that Jesus holds the key of David, symbolizing His authority to open and shut the doors of salvation. This imagery reflects His unique role in mediating access to God and His covenant promises. The key represents His control over who enters into covenant relationship with God, emphasizing that He is the ultimate source of salvation. Throughout Scripture, this truth is underscored, showing that no one can gain access to God's presence or partake in His grace apart from Christ's sovereign act of opening individual hearts to the gospel.
Scripture References: Revelation 3:7, Isaiah 22:20-23
